Rebecca Monteith GARDEN was b. 17sep1821 at Glasgow (familysearch); actual birthplace was not always recorded as Glasgow in census. Rebecca (17sep1821 Dalserf-8apr1890 Liberton, Midlothian) (D. Brown, rootsweb). Will (9 pages) of Rebecca Monteith Brown or Garden, Yewlands, Liberton, widow of John George Brown, son of Thomas Brown of Auchenlochan, d. 8apr1890 at Yewlands (scotlandspeople). Rebecca Monteath GARDEN marr John George BROWN 25jul1843, Lesmahagow, Lanarks. (familysearch). Rebecca Monteith, only dau of Alexander Garden, esq., was marr by Rev. Francis Garden (Trinity Ch., Greenwich), to John George Brown, esq., 25jul1843 (Glasgow Herald). John George BROWN (1818 N. Carolina, USA-1882 Scotland) (Dennis Brown, rootsweb) was son of Thomas Brown of Auchlochan (NZ newpapers) and Martha Daniel. In 1851 Alexander E. Monteith (1794 Glasgow, advocate, sheriff of Fife), wife Frances (1805 England), children, Mary Anna (1831 Edinburgh, unm), Anna Julia (1843 Pacaitland/Pencaitland, E. Lothian), niece Maria R. Brown (1832 Edinburgh, unm), visitor Rebecca M. Brown (1822 Glasgow, merchts wife), visitors (merchts children, b. Edinburgh), Thomas N.M. (findmypast)/Thomas U.M. (freecen) Brown (1845), Rebecca M. (1847), Alexander F. Brown (1851), were at Inverleith House, Edinburgh (census). Alexander Earl Montieth marr Frances, dau of Lt Gen James Wallace-Dunlop (thepeerage). In 1861 John G. Brown (1818 USA, Capt, Royal Lanarks. Militia, mercht), wife Rebecca M. (1822 Glasgow), children, Thomas H.M. (1845 Edinburgh), Rebecca M.G. (1847 Edinburgh), Sarah F. (1848 Carstairs, Lanarks.), Alexander F.G. (1851), John G. (1853 Musselburgh), James R. (1854 Musselburgh), mother in law Rebecca Garden (1791 Glasgow), were at Edinburgh (census). In 1871 John George Brown (1818 USA, mercht) and Rebecca Monteith Brown (1822 Carluke, Lanarks.), both marr, were at Moulin, Perths. (census). In 1881 Mrs. Monti Alston (1847 Edinburgh, wid, private means), sister in law Jane Alston (1826 Glasgow, unm, private means), visitors John Brown (1818 Virginia, N. Carolina, marr, interest of money), Rebecca M. Brown (1822 Dalsorf, Lanarks., marr, interest of money), were at Edinburgh (census); the visitors were the parents of Monti. |
